Problem. In this problem, the deck refers to a standard set of 52 cards (4 suits of 13 values, namely 2-10, J, Q, K, A). For each case, determine whether the given pair of events is independent.

  1. “A randomly selected card from the deck is of the hearts suit” and “A randomly selected card from the deck is a “picture” card (i.e., jack, queen, or king)”.

  2. “Two randomly selected cards from the deck are both black” and “Two randomly selected cards form a pair (i.e., have the same value)”.

  3. “A randomly selected card from the deck is a ten” and “A randomly selected card from the deck is a jack”.

  4. “Among a randomly selected pair of cards, at least one is of the hearts suit” and “Among a randomly selected pair of cards, at least one is an ace”.

  5. “A randomly selected pair of cards from the deck consists of different suits” and “Among a randomly selected pair of cards, at least one is a “picture” card”.
